episode I'm a Pisces and you're a Gemini (model) artwork

I'm a Pisces and you're a Gemini (model)

This week on the show, we dive into the many, many announcements from Google I/O 2026, including new Gemini models, how ads will inevitably end up in Google's AI products, and whether the singularity is nigh (derogatory). Plus, our feelings on reality TV and 90s daytime television. We miss you, Bob Barker. Get your pets spade or neutered! episode The Googlebook can't be real, can it? artwork

The Googlebook can't be real, can it?

This week on the show, Stephen and Daniel dive into wonderful world of Google's Android Show, where they discuss the Googlebook; Android 17's Agentic AI transformation; and whether AI art is ever actually satisfying. Plus, a primer on cognitive surrender, and why Daniel always finds himself getting existential at around the three-quarter mark of every episode. episode AI can't solve your laziness problem artwork

AI can't solve your laziness problem

In this week's episode, Stephen and Daniel delve into the evolution of fitness trackers by looking at the Fitbit Air; Google’s new universal AI-powered health platform; and the negative implications of smart glasses with cameras. Plus, Daniel gets addicted to vibe coding (it was only a matter of time) and Stephen teaches us how to bowl like a pro.
